Pre-Monsoon Hair Care Routine for Frizz Control

With rising humidity before the monsoon, frizzy hair becomes a common problem. Moisture in the air disrupts the hair's natural texture, causing dryness, breakage, and frizz.

A simple pre-monsoon routine can help manage the chaos. Here’s how to keep your locks smooth and frizz-free:

Switch to a Sulfate-Free Shampoo: Sulfates strip your scalp of natural oils. Use a gentle, sulfate-free shampoo to maintain moisture and reduce frizz.

Deep Condition Weekly: Humidity makes hair porous and dry. Use a deep conditioning mask once a week to hydrate and strengthen strands.

Apply Leave-In Conditioner or Serum: A leave-in conditioner or anti-frizz serum adds a protective barrier against moisture, keeping hair manageable.

Avoid Heat Styling: Blow-drying or ironing can worsen frizz. Let your hair air-dry and use heat only when necessary with a heat protectant.

Oil Your Hair Twice a Week: Coconut or argan oil helps retain moisture and prevents hair from puffing up in humid weather.

Use a Microfiber Towel: Switch to a microfiber towel or cotton T-shirt to dry your hair—this reduces friction and frizz.

Trim Split Ends Regularly: Humidity worsens split ends. Trim your hair every 6-8 weeks to maintain healthy tips.
